Research Scientist Post at the University of Virginia – Postdoc Biology Candidates Apply

Application Now Open for Research Scientist Position at the University of Virginia’s Center for Public Health Genomics – APPLY BELOW!

Role : Research Scientist, Center for Public Health Genomics

Locations : Charlottesville, VA

Time type : Full time

Job requisition id : R0052167

Job Description :

  • The Center for Public Health Genomics at the University of Virginia is seeking a Research Scientist to perform statistical analysis of high-throughput molecular ‘omics data sets for collaborative projects at the cutting edge of human genetics, genomics, and high-throughput molecular ‘omics research
  • The successful candidate will join a collegial and productive research team focused on the statistical analysis of human genetic studies, analysis of high-throughput molecular ‘omics data, and integration of genomic and molecular ‘omics data to identify disease-related molecular targets.
  • Analytical responsibilities will include analysis of bulk and single-cell transcriptomic data sets, genetic association analysis of common and rare disease variants and integrative systems genetics analysis of multi-omics data.
  • Collaborative efforts will include an emphasis on post-GWAS studies including whole genome sequence analysis, targeted analysis of candidate genes, and integrative analysis of genomic and transcriptomic data in studies of cardiovascular disease, atherosclerosis, diabetes and pulmonary diseases.

Skills Required for the Research Scientist Post :

  • The Research Scientist position requires a doctoral degree in Biostatistics, Computational Biology, Genetics, Epidemiology, or a related field.
  • Knowledge of statistics and genetics; experience with statistical software (R or Python).
  • A strong work ethic.
  • The ability to work independently combined with willingness to work in a highly interactive and collegial group; and excellent written and oral communication skills.

Desired qualifications :

  • Experience working with large-scale multi-center studies.
  • Working knowledge of existing tools for genetic analysis and data management.
  • Shell scripting and experience working in a Unix / Linux environment.
  • Research Scientists are expected to perform assigned tasks independently.
  • In addition to a firm background in the particular field, Research Scientists should demonstrate the ability to lead small groups and work without additional supervision once objectives are defined and methods of approach are set.

Here are some potential interview questions and sample answers for the Research Scientist Post

1. Can you briefly describe your experience in statistical analysis of high-throughput molecular ‘omics data sets and its relevance to this position?

Sample Answer: In my previous role as a Research Scientist at [Previous Institution/Company], I worked extensively on the statistical analysis of high-throughput molecular ‘omics data sets. I have experience in analyzing bulk and single-cell transcriptomic data, conducting genetic association analysis for common and rare disease variants, and integrating multi-omics data to identify disease-related molecular targets. This experience has equipped me with the skills necessary for this position’s analytical responsibilities.

2. What statistical software are you proficient in, and can you provide an example of a complex analysis you’ve conducted using R or Python?

Sample Answer: I am proficient in both R and Python for statistical analysis. In a recent project, I used R to perform a genome-wide association study (GWAS) to identify genetic variants associated with a specific cardiovascular disease. I conducted data preprocessing, quality control, and applied various statistical tests to pinpoint significant associations. This project resulted in the discovery of novel genetic markers linked to the disease.

3. How do you manage and prioritize your work when faced with multiple collaborative projects and tight deadlines?

Sample Answer: Effective time management and prioritization are essential in research. I typically start by assessing the urgency and importance of each task or project. I then create a detailed project plan that includes milestones and deadlines. Regular communication with collaborators helps me stay on track and adjust priorities if necessary. Additionally, I am open to delegating tasks when appropriate to ensure that all projects progress smoothly and meet their deadlines.

4. Can you share an example of a challenging problem you encountered during your previous research and how you approached solving it?

Sample Answer: In a previous research project, we were dealing with a large and complex multi-omics dataset with significant missing data. To address this challenge, I first conducted thorough data quality assessments to identify missing data patterns. I then applied advanced imputation techniques to fill in the gaps while considering the nature of the data. This allowed us to maintain the integrity of the dataset and proceed with our analysis. It also reinforced the importance of data preprocessing and quality control in research.

5. How do you stay updated with the latest developments in the field of genomics and high-throughput molecular ‘omics research?

Sample Answer: Staying current in this rapidly evolving field is crucial. I regularly attend conferences, seminars, and workshops related to genomics and ‘omics research. I also subscribe to relevant scientific journals and follow reputable research organizations and experts on social media platforms. Engaging with the scientific community through discussions and collaborations helps me stay informed about the latest advancements, which I can then apply to my work.
